400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么有的excel大

作者:路由通
|
85人看过
发布时间:2025-09-10 21:27:21
标签:
本文深入探讨了Excel文件体积过大的多种原因,从数据量、公式复杂度到嵌入对象等方面详细分析,结合官方资料和实际案例,帮助用户理解并优化文件大小,提升工作效率。
为什么有的excel大

       在日常使用Excel时,许多用户都会遇到文件体积异常庞大的情况,这不仅影响打开和保存速度,还可能导致系统卡顿或崩溃。根据微软官方文档,Excel文件的大小受多种因素影响,包括数据内容、格式设置、外部链接等。本文将系统性地解析这些原因,并提供实用案例,助您更好地管理Excel文件。

       数据量过大导致文件膨胀

       Excel文件的核心是数据,当工作表包含大量行和列时,文件体积自然会增加。微软官方指出,每个单元格存储数据时都会占用一定空间,尤其是文本和数字数据。例如,一个销售报表如果包含超过10万行记录,文件大小可能轻松突破10MB。案例中,某企业的年度财务数据表因记录了过去五年的交易明细,导致文件达到50MB,严重影响共享和编辑效率。另一个案例是用户导入整个数据库导出,未经筛选直接存入Excel,使得文件膨胀至数百MB。

       复杂公式和函数增加计算负担

       公式和函数是Excel的强大功能,但过度使用或复杂嵌套会显著增大文件。根据微软支持文章,每个公式都需要存储计算逻辑和引用关系,占用额外空间。例如,使用数组公式或VLOOKUP跨多表查询时,文件体积可能翻倍。案例中,一个预算分析表因包含大量SUMIF和INDEX-MATCH公式,文件大小从5MB增至15MB。另一案例是用户使用动态数组公式处理实时数据,导致文件持续增长。

       嵌入图片和对象占用大量空间

       在Excel中插入图片、图表或其他对象(如PDF附件)会直接增加文件体积。微软文档强调,未压缩的图像文件尤其占用资源。例如,插入高分辨率公司logo或多个图表后,文件可能增加数MB。案例中,一份市场报告因嵌入10张高清图片,文件大小从2MB飙升至20MB。另一案例是用户将整个演示文稿嵌入Excel作为附件,导致文件异常庞大。

       过多格式设置和样式累积

       单元格格式、颜色、字体和边框等设置虽然提升可读性,但过多应用会累积占用空间。官方资料显示,每个格式规则都存储为元数据。例如,对整个工作表应用条件格式或自定义样式,文件体积可能增加30%。案例中,一个项目计划表因使用多种颜色和字体样式,文件大小翻倍。另一案例是用户复制粘贴带格式的内容,引入冗余样式。

       宏和VBA代码嵌入增加负担

       宏和VBA脚本为用户提供自动化功能,但代码存储会增大文件。微软指出,宏模块作为文本数据存储,尤其复杂脚本占空间大。例如,一个包含多个宏的财务报表,文件可能额外增加5-10MB。案例中,某自动化工具表因嵌入VBA代码处理数据,文件达到25MB。另一案例是用户录制宏后未清理,代码累积导致膨胀。

       冗余数据历史未清理

       Excel文件可能保留已删除或隐藏的数据历史,这些冗余信息占用空间。官方文档提到,删除行或列后,部分数据可能仍存于文件结构中。例如,频繁编辑的工作表容易积累垃圾数据。案例中,一个库存管理表因多次删除旧记录,文件大小仍保持较大。另一案例是用户使用“清除”功能不彻底,残留数据导致文件无法缩小。

       外部数据链接和查询引入额外负载

       链接到外部数据库或网页的查询会存储连接信息和缓存数据,增大文件。微软支持说明,数据透视表或Power Query导入外部源时,文件体积增加。例如,一个实时股票分析表链接到在线数据源,文件包含查询缓存达10MB。案例中,用户设置自动刷新外部链接,每次更新都累积数据。

       缓存和临时数据未优化

       Excel在操作过程中生成缓存和临时文件,这些可能被误保存到主文件。官方资料指出,未保存的更改或恢复数据会暂存。例如,崩溃恢复后文件包含额外信息。案例中,一个大型项目文件因多次崩溃恢复,体积增加15%。另一案例是用户忽略清理临时文件,导致累积。

       版本兼容性问题导致结构复杂

       不同Excel版本间的兼容性设置可能添加额外元数据,以支持旧功能,从而增大文件。微软文档强调,保存为兼容模式时文件结构更复杂。例如,将新版本文件另存为Excel 97-2003格式,体积增加。案例中,企业为兼容旧系统保存文件,导致大小翻倍。另一案例是用户在不同版本间频繁切换,引入冗余信息。

       多工作表结构分散资源

       工作簿中包含大量工作表时,每个表都独立存储数据和格式,累加后文件变大。官方说明,每个工作表有最小开销。例如,一个包含50个工作表的财务模型,文件可能超过100MB。案例中,用户为每个月份创建单独表,文件体积剧增。另一案例是模板文件带多个空表,未删除则浪费空间。

       不一致的单元格格式增加元数据

       单元格格式不一致,如混合使用数字、文本和日期格式,会导致Excel存储更多元数据来管理差异。根据微软指南,优化格式可减小文件。例如,一个数据导入表格式杂乱,文件增大20%。案例中,用户从多个源粘贴数据,格式不统一造成膨胀。另一案例是未使用样式统一化。

       数据验证和条件规则累积

       数据验证规则和条件格式虽然实用,但每个规则都存储为逻辑条件,占用空间。官方资料显示,复杂规则链尤其耗资源。例如,一个表单设置多级验证,文件体积增加。案例中,一个调查表包含大量下拉列表和条件格式,文件达8MB。另一案例是用户复制带规则的单元格,规则重复。

       图表和图形元素嵌入细节

       图表、形状和SmartArt图形嵌入时存储矢量或位图数据,增大文件。微软指出,未简化的图表占空间大。例如,一个报告嵌入多个动态图表,文件增加10MB。案例中,用户使用高细节图表展示数据,体积膨胀。另一案例是复制图表从其他应用,带额外数据。

       隐藏的行和列保留数据

       隐藏行或列并不意味着数据被删除,它们仍占用文件空间。官方文档说明,隐藏元素需存储状态信息。例如,一个分析表隐藏大量中间计算行,文件大小未减。案例中,用户为整洁隐藏数据,但文件仍大。另一案例是批量隐藏未清理。

       合并单元格导致结构复杂化

       合并单元格虽改善外观,但增加文件结构复杂性,存储更多元数据。微软建议谨慎使用以避免膨胀。例如,一个标题行多次合并,文件体积微增。案例中,用户广泛合并单元格用于布局,文件变大。另一案例是合并后未优化。

       综上所述,Excel文件体积过大的原因多样,涉及数据、格式、对象和设置等方面。通过识别这些因素并采用优化策略,如清理冗余、压缩对象和统一格式,用户可以有效控制文件大小,提升使用体验和效率。

相关文章
word文件是什么文件
Word文件是由微软开发的文字处理软件创建的一种文档格式,广泛应用于办公、教育和日常工作中。本文将全面解析其定义、历史演变、文件结构、功能特性、实际应用案例及官方资源,提供深度且实用的指南,帮助读者彻底理解Word文档的方方面面。
2025-09-10 21:26:32
239人看过
word中什么是首页
在微软Word文档处理中,首页作为文档的门面,不仅承载着标题和作者信息,更影响着整体专业形象。本文将深入解析首页的定义、功能设置方法,并通过实际案例探讨其在商业、学术等场景的应用,帮助用户掌握高效使用技巧,提升文档质量。
2025-09-10 21:26:30
192人看过
为什么word打印很慢
为什么Word文档打印速度缓慢?本文深度解析18个核心原因,涵盖文档复杂性、系统资源、打印机设置等多方面,并提供实用案例和解决方案,帮助您高效解决打印问题。
2025-09-10 21:26:03
86人看过
word为什么显示光标
本文深入解析Microsoft Word中光标显示的背后原因与实用功能,从技术原理到用户体验,涵盖光标的作用、闪烁机制、常见问题及解决方法,帮助用户更好地理解和使用这一基础编辑工具。
2025-09-10 21:25:45
176人看过
word为什么引用无效
在使用Microsoft Word进行文档编辑时,引用功能无效是一个常见问题,可能导致学术写作或商业报告中的参考文献无法正确显示。本文深入分析了18个核心原因,包括软件设置、文件管理和用户操作等方面,每个论点辅以实际案例和官方资料支持,帮助用户快速定位并解决引用失效问题,提升文档编辑效率。
2025-09-10 21:25:00
196人看过
word文档转什么格式
本文全面解析Word文档转换的12种核心格式,涵盖办公、出版、编程等多元场景。基于微软官方技术文档,详解每种格式的转换方法、适用场景及实操案例,帮助用户根据具体需求选择最佳转换方案。
2025-09-10 21:24:38
398人看过